The Importance of a Consistent Schedule

A consistent weekly schedule helps truckers plan their routes, rest periods, and personal time. It reduces fatigue, increases efficiency, and ensures compliance with regulations such as Hours of Service (HOS). For New Orleans truckers, balancing city traffic, port operations, and regional deliveries requires careful planning.

  • Five-Day Workweek with Weekends Off: Many drivers prefer working Monday through Friday, allowing weekends for rest and personal activities.
  • Four-On, Three-Off Rotation: This schedule involves working four days and then taking three days off, providing extended rest periods.
  • Split Shifts: Some drivers split their workdays into two shifts, accommodating city traffic patterns and delivery windows.

Factors Influencing Schedule Choice

Several factors influence which schedule works best, including:

  • Type of Cargo: Perishable goods may require more flexible or shorter shifts.
  • Delivery Locations: Port deliveries or regional routes impact scheduling flexibility.
  • Regulatory Compliance: Adhering to Hours of Service rules is critical for safety and legal reasons.
  • Personal Preferences: Family commitments and personal health influence schedule choices.
